Pairing Natural Leaf with Other Fonts for Visual Balance

If you’re using Natural Leaf for branding, it’s best to pair it with something simple. I often combine it with a modern sans serif like Montserrat or a clean serif like Playfair Display. This helps maintain readability while still keeping the design visually interesting. Whether it’s for a logo design or a product label, the contrast between Natural Leaf and a more neutral font helps guide the eye and makes your message stand out.
